Calcio Storico Fiorentino 2014 [Reference: 2]

Note: *Match suspended after 34 minutes due to a player from Verdi refusing to leave the field after being ejected. Match awarded to Rossi.

Note 2: Final Cancelled by Mayor Dario Nardella due to tensions arisng over the abandoned Semi-Final.

Report

The 2014 Calcio Fiorentino Final was cancelled due to tensions arising out of the abandoned Semi-Final between Rossi di Santa Maria Novella and Verdi di San Giovanni which was awarded to Rossi after a Verdi player refused to leave the field after being ejected.

The Rossi were due to meet Bianchi di Santo Spirito in the Final after they defeated Azzurri di Santa Croce in the other Semi-Final.

Report

Bianchi di Santo Spirito won the Calcio Fiorentino in 2015 with a 4½ to ½ triumph over Verdi San Giovanni in the Final. They had defeated Rossi di Santa Maria Novella in the Semi-Finals.

Report

Bianchi di Santo Spirito won the Calcio Fiorentino in 2016, with a narrow 6½ to 6 win over Azzurri di Santa Croce in the Final, after winning by 3 against Verdi di San Giovanni (8-5) in the Semi-Finals.

Report

Oban Celtic in 2016, Lochside Rovers in 2017, Bute in 2018 and Aberdour in 2019 were the Champions of the Camanachd Association South Division 1 from 2016 to 2019. The South Division 1 is the top Regional Division in Scottish Men’s Shinty below the two National Divisions.

Report

Newtownmore won the Shinty North Division 1 four years in succession from 2016 to 2019. The North is one of two regional structures underneath the two National Divisions in the Camanachd Association Shinty Men’s Leagues.

Shinty is a stick-an-ball game that has the same origins as Hurling and is most popular in the Scottish Highlands.

Report

The National Division is the second division of the Camanachd Association Men’s Shinty Leagues, and was reinstated in 2016 after a gap of 9 years (it was previously known as Division 1 from 2000 to 2007).

Champions, and thus promoted to the Shinty Premiership from 2016 to 2019 were Kilmallie in 2016, Skye in 2017, Kilmallie again in 2018 and Fort William in 2019. The 2020 season was cancelled due to the COVID-19 Coronavirus Pandemic.

European Soccer Super League Proposition

With the new World Club Cup from next year being a 24-team tournament like the World Cup for countries, and the Coronavirus COVID-19 Pandemic bringing to full focus the amount of games players are playing and the need for safety in scheduling, Eirball takes a look at what could be a solution to the problem of a European Super League.

While reading the South American Football Yearbook 2020-2021 by Gabriel Mantz, available at Soccer Books Limited: http://www.soccer-books.com/ the author noticed that the Brazilian State League run alongside the Brazilian National Championship i.e teams take part in both, with the State Leagues taking up the first 2-3 months before the National Championship takes over.

Here is the suggestion for the possibility of a European Super League: that teams continue to play in their National League for the first 5-6 months, playing a 30-34 game schedule, and then the top teams play in a European Super League with two levels for the last 3 months. It is possible to have the 32 team format, teams could just be divided into 2 groups of 18 (36 teams) based on geography (North and South or East and West) and play a 17-game schedule with the top 8 of each group reaching a knockout phase played, like this summers Champions League, over the course of two weeks in a single host country, chosen beforehand. There could be relegation and promotion wthin the two levels. Eirball has stuck with EU countries for this line-up. Turkey and the CIS countries could also be involved.

Note: 6 Pts Win, 3 Pts Tie, 0 Pts Loss, 1 Pt per Goal Scored up to a Maximum of 3 per Game.

Note 2: After the season Philadelphia Spartans and Pittsburgh Phantoms folded, Chicago Spurs moved to Kansas City, Los Angeles Toros moved to San Diego and the League merged with the USA to form the North American Soccer League.

Report

There were two professional soccer leagues in North America in 1967, both attempting at the same time to bring Pro Soccer to USA & Canada. The United Soccer Association was the FIFA-sponsored league and featured teams from Europe and South America guesting as North American teams over a Summer Schedule in between their normal Winter schedules. It included Shamrock Rovers (playing as Boston Rovers) and Glentoran (playing as Detroit Cougars). The other league was the National Professional Soccer League, and after the season the two leagues merged in 1968 to form the North American Soccer League which lasted until 1984.

Two Irishmen, Eric Barber & Joe Haverty played for the Chicago Spurs in 1967, and the Kansas City Spurs (After the team moved) in 1968. [Reference: 5-6]

Note: 2 Pts Win, 1 Pt Draw, 0 Pts Loss; Teams were actually teams from Ireland, Northern Ireland, Scotland, England, Italy, Netherlands and Uruguay representing US cities on a Summer Schedule in between their normal Winter Schedules back home. See Below for Teams.

Note 2: After the season Toronto City and New York Skyliners folded, and San Francisco Gales were absorbed by Vancouver Royal Canadians., and the League merged with the NPSL to form the North American Soccer League.

USA Teams

USA TeamEuropean/South American Team
Boston RoversShamrock Rovers (Dublin, Ireland)
Chicago MustangsCagliari (Italy)
Cleveland StokersStoke City (England)
Dallas TornadoDundee United (Scotland)
Detroit CougarsGlentoran (Northern Ireland)
Houston StarsBangu (Brazil)
Los Angeles WolvesWolverhampton Wanderers (England)
New York SkylinersCerro (Montevideo, Uruguay)
San Francisco GalesAD) (Den Haag, Netherlands)
Toronto CityHibernian (Edinburgh, Scotland)
Vancouver Royal CanadiansSunderland (England)
Washington WhipsAberdeen (Scotland)
United Soccer Association Teams 1967 [Reference: 3]

Report

There were two professional soccer leagues in North America in 1967, both attempting at the same time to bring Pro Soccer to USA & Canada. The United Soccer Association was the FIFA-sponsored league and featured teams from Europe and South America guesting as North American teams over a Summer Schedule in between their normal Winter schedules. It included Shamrock Rovers (playing as Boston Rovers) and Glentoran (playing as Detroit Cougars). The other league was the National Professional Soccer League, and after the season the two leagues merged in 1968 to form the North American Soccer League which lasted until 1984.

Among the Rovers players over in Boston were Liam Tuohy, Frank O’Neill, Paddy Mulligan, Davy Pugh ad Tommy Kelly.

The side also included Carlos Metidieri, A Brazilian-born USA International, as gueat player, and his younger brother, Gilson.

After the merger with the NPSL, the Boston Rovers side became the Boston Beacons, a team in its own right, but kept the link with Shamrock Rovers. Paddy Mulligan was loaned out to the Beacons side in 1968 by Shamrock Rovers, but most of the team returned, and the side lost its mainly Irish make-up. [Reference: 4]
